Key Responsibilities:
- Lead continuous improvement projects using Lean/Six Sigma methodologies.
- Map current/future processes, identify gaps, and drive corrective actions.
- Partner with leadership to analyze workflows and develop improvement plans.
- Build and execute roadmaps for CI initiatives across teams.
- Monitor KPIs, track performance metrics, and validate improvement outcomes.
- Conduct root cause analysis, resolve incidents, and implement sustainable solutions.
- Coach and guide teams on CI tools, best practices, and innovation culture.
- Improve manufacturing processes, tools, and systems to enhance production and quality.
- Manage strategic projects and ensure alignment with business goals.
Requirements:
- Experience: 3–5+ years in continuous improvement, process engineering, or operational excellence.
- Skills: Strong knowledge of Lean, Six Sigma, Kaizen, and process mapping.
- Technologies: Familiarity with data analysis tools, KPI dashboards, and manufacturing systems.
- Competencies: Analytical mindset, problem-solving, leadership, and ability to drive cross-functional initiatives.
- Education: Bachelor’s degree in Engineering, Operations Management, or related field (Lean/Six Sigma certification preferred)
